Standards Used in China

Product Details: Chinese standards system including mandatory and voluntary standards for various industries.

Technical Parameters:
– Four levels of standards: National, Professional, Local, Enterprise
– Codes for identifying standards: GB, GB/T, DB + *, Q + *

Application Scenarios:
– Compliance with safety and health regulations in China
– Standardization across industries for product quality

Pros:
– Ensures safety and quality of products
– Facilitates international trade and compliance

Cons:
– Complexity in navigating multiple standards
– Potential for outdated standards if not regularly updated

1. What are the key standards for manufacturing factories in China?
In China, key standards include ISO 9001 for quality management, ISO 14001 for environmental management, and OHSAS 18001 for occupational health and safety. These standards help ensure that factories operate efficiently, maintain quality, and protect the environment and workers’ health.

2. How can I ensure my factory complies with Chinese manufacturing standards?

To ensure compliance, you should conduct regular audits, train your staff on relevant standards, and implement quality control processes. Collaborating with local experts or consultants can also help you navigate the regulatory landscape effectively.

3. What role do safety standards play in Chinese manufacturing?

Safety standards are crucial in protecting workers and minimizing accidents. Compliance with standards like GB 50016 ensures that factories maintain safe working conditions, which not only protects employees but also enhances productivity and reduces liability.

4. Are there specific environmental regulations for factories in China?

Yes, factories in China must adhere to environmental regulations such as the Environmental Protection Law and various local regulations. These laws focus on waste management, emissions control, and resource conservation to promote sustainable manufacturing practices.

5. How often do manufacturing standards in China change?

Manufacturing standards in China can change frequently, often in response to new technologies, environmental concerns, or international trade agreements. It’s essential to stay updated on these changes to ensure ongoing compliance and competitiveness in the market.
